The Harvard Yacht Club last night announced its new officers for the 1950-1951 season. Elected were Frank P. Scully, Jr. '51, Commodore; Tom J. Carroll '52, Vice Commodore; John B. Gardner '51, Secretary; and Phillip W. Smith '51, Treasurer.
Scully replaces Augustus L. Putnam III '50, who was Commodore during the 1949-1950 season. Carroll was elected chairman of the dinghy committee for the New England Intercollegiate Sailing Association early in February.
